Today’s installment of campaign-related news items from across the country.
* Senate Foreign Relations Committee Chairman Bob Corker (R-Tenn.) jolted the political world yesterday announcing he’ll retire at the end of his term next year. So far, Corker is the only Senate incumbent in either party who’s announced his retirement.
* In Virginia’s gubernatorial race, the latest Monmouth University poll shows Ralph Northam (D) with a five-point advantage over Ed Gillespie (R), 49% to 44%.
* On a related note, a new poll from Christopher Newport University shows Northam with a similar lead, 47% to 41%.
* Donald Trump will travel to Indiana today to help promote his party’s tax-reform package, and he’ll be joined by Sen. Joe Donnelly (D-Ind.), a red-state Democratic incumbent facing a tough challenge in next year’s midterms.
